US East Coast Dockworkers Head Toward Strike After Deal Deadline Passes
Dockworkers on the U.S. East Coast and Gulf Coast were expected to strike on Tuesday morning after a midnight deadline passed with no sign of a new contract deal with port owners. The strike is forecast to halt about half the nation's ocean shipping.
